Presidential TFR NOTAM Issued for PBI Area on February 3-6, 2017

Back NATA News / February 3, 2017

On February 2nd, the Federal Aviation Administration (FAA) issued a VIP Temporary Flight Restriction (TFR) Notice to Airmen (NOTAM) FDC 7/0643 for the Palm Beach area beginning February 3, 2017 and ending on February 6, 2017. The NOTAM states TSA screening will be available from February 4-5, 2017 from 0800 local until 1700 local, and February 6, 2017 from 0800 local until 1000 local. To help accommodate aircraft arriving at Palm Beach International Airport (KPBI), the Transportation Security Administration (TSA) created inbound gateway screening airports at Orlando International Airport (KMCO: Signature Flight Support/Atlantic Aviation), Fort Lauderdale International Airport (KFLL: Shelt Air), Dulles International Airport (KIAD: Dulles Jet Center/Signature Flight Support/Jet Aviation), Teterboro Airport (KTEB: Signature South), and Westchester Co. Airport (KHPN: Taxi Way Charlie). Outbound gateway screening is available at PBI at the following locations: Signature Flight Support, Atlantic Aviation, NetJets, and Jet Aviation. All passengers over 18 years of age must present a valid pictured government issued identification.
